"World Geography and Cultures" by National Geographic is an expansive exploration of the world's diverse landscapes, cultures, and peoples. The book features vivid photographs and detailed maps that bring to life the geographical features that define various regions. Readers will journey through continents, discovering the cultural practices, histories, and economies that shape societies. Engaging text and interactive elements encourage critical thinking about global issues and the interconnectedness of different cultures. This resource serves as an essential tool for understanding both the physical world and the human experience, fostering a deeper appreciation for the planet’s rich diversity. DINAH ZIKE is an educational author, consultant, lecturer, and product developer with her own company, Dinah-Might Activities, Inc. , based in San Antonio, Texas. She is the author of numerous books and activity materials in science, history, reading, and other areas of special interest to children, teachers, and parents. Catherine Hughes, M. Ed. , is the Executive Editor, Preschool Content, at National Geographic. She is the author of several books in the NG Little Kids First Big Book series.
